Quette Question...

Ive been dating an Omega man for over a year now. I attend many, almost all events that arent members only. Ive been reading about the Quettes and wonder if i qualify, since i am the "sweetheart" of an Omega Psi Phi man? Do I have to get permission from him? Do I introduce myself to them? What steps do i take? I am not in any sorority so i think it would be nice for us to have that connection in common.

I don't know if it is different at different schools; however, the way one of my Q Dog friends explained it was that if his girlfriend joined was that she would talk with him about joining, he in turned would talk with the Quettes and the Quettes would then talk with her about it. From my understanding there was some other stuff going on with this process, but I don't know what.

I do have to say that this was said in public at a Tri-Council meeting (CPC, NPHC, and IFC combined) during part of our diversity seminars about how different GLOs do different things, so it might not be the entire process.
